Pine wood siding installation involves attaching high-quality pine wood panels to the exterior walls of a property, providing a natural and classic look. This service typically includes preparing the existing surface, measuring and cutting the wood panels to fit precisely, and securely fastening them to ensure durability. Proper installation is essential to protect the home from weather elements, prevent moisture intrusion, and enhance the overall appearance of the property. Experienced contractors use techniques that help ensure the siding remains in good condition over time, maintaining its aesthetic appeal and structural integrity.

This service helps address common problems such as wood rot, warping, or damage caused by exposure to moisture and pests. Over time, siding can deteriorate, leading to increased energy costs and potential structural issues if not properly maintained. Pine wood siding installation can serve as a solution to revitalize an aging exterior, improve insulation, and prevent further damage. It also offers an opportunity to upgrade the look of a home, adding character and value through the warm, natural appearance of pine wood.

The overview below groups typical Pine Wood Siding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Harrison, OH.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or siding repairs or patchwork in Harrison, OH range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, especially when only a few sections need attention.

Partial Replacement - Replacing sections of damaged or rotted pine wood siding us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Larger, more involved projects can reach $4,000 or more, but most fall into the middle tier.

Full Siding Installation - Complete pine wood siding installation for a standard-sized home often ranges from $5,000 to $10,000. Projects at the higher end tend to be larger or more complex, with many jobs landing in the middle of this range.

Custom or High-End Projects - Custom designs or extensive siding upgrades can exceed $12,000, though these are less common. Most local contractors handle typical installations within the standard cost bands mentioned above.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of choosing pine wood siding for a home? Pine wood siding offers a natural appearance, durability, and can enhance the aesthetic appeal of a property with proper installation and maintenance.

How do local contractors prepare for pine wood siding installation? Contractors typically assess the existing structure, select appropriate materials, and ensure proper surface preparation to achieve a quality installation.

What maintenance is required after installing pine wood siding? Regular painting or staining, cleaning, and inspections for damage help maintain the appearance and longevity of pine wood siding.

Can pine wood siding be installed on any type of building? Pine wood siding can be installed on various residential structures, but a professional assessment is recommended to determine suitability.

What factors influence the installation process of pine wood siding? Factors include the building’s design, climate conditions, and the condition of the existing exterior surface, which local service providers can evaluate.
